Chocolate Fudge Peanut Butter Pretzel Bars

Chocolate Fudge Peanut Butter Pretzel Bars have layers of a no bake peanut butter pretzel bar, topped with easy chocolate fudge made with sweetened condensed milk and chocolate chips, and then finished off with a pretzel on top. These bars are the perfect sweet & salty combo that is irresistible!

Ingredients

  • 2 cups finely crushed pretzels
  • 1 cup graham cracker crumbs
  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• cup creamy peanut butter divided
  • 12 tablespoons salted butter divided
  • 1 can (14 oz) sweetened condensed milk
  • 24 ounces milk chocolate chips
  • 28 whole mini pretzels (for topping)

Instructions

  • Prepare a 9x13 baking dish by lining with parchment paper, cooking spray, or spread with softened butter. Set aside.
  • In a large mixing bowl stir together the crushed pretzels, graham cracker crumbs, and powder sugar.

  • Melt 8 tablespoons of butter in the microwave and add it into the mixing bowl along with 1 cup of the creamy peanut butter.
    Stir until well combined and the dry mixture is saturated.

  • Press the crushed pretzel and butter mixture into the prepared pan.
  • In a microwave-safe bowl, add the remaining 4 tablespoons of butter and the sweetened condensed milk.
    Microwave for about 45 seconds (or longer) until the butter is melted completely and the sweetened condensed milk is very warm.

  • Immediately stir in the milk chocolate chips and the remaining 1/4 cup of creamy peanut butter. Stir until it's completely combined and smooth.
    * Have the peanut butter & chocolate chips measured out and ready to dump right in.

  • Quickly pour the chocolate fudge over the peanut butter pretzel layer and smooth it out.
    * The fudge mixture will set up quickly so make sure that you mix it quickly, but completely, and then immediately pour it over the pretzel layer.

  • Top the chocolate fudge layer with whole mini pretzels. Cover the pan in plastic wrap or a lid, and refrigerate for 1 hour before slicing and serving.
    * These can be refrigerated for longer, up to 8 hours or overnight, if wanted. Eat straight from the fridge or let the bars sit at room temperature for just a few minutes to soften up.
    * Use as many, or as little, whole pretzels that you want. Whatever the amount of squares you are going to cut is how many pretzels you will need for the top.

Notes

Chocolate Chips : Some brands sell a larger 23 ounce size bag and that's just fine in this recipe. 
Butter : Unsalted butter can be used if that's what you prefer. I like the sweet & salty contrast so I always use salted butter. 
12 tablespoons of butter is equal to 3/4 cup OR 1 stick + 1/4 stick of butter
Variation Ideas -
  • Chocolate : I highly recommend using milk chocolate chips in this recipe but if you really want to, you can use semi-sweet chocolate chips if you prefer. 
  • Pretzels : Use a bag of mini pretzels because you need whole pretzels to top the bars off with. That being said, you can also use whatever pretzels you have like sticks or snaps. Instead of whole pretzels on top, chop some pretzels and sprinkle them over the fudge layer. 
  • Topping : Instead of whole pretzels, or in addition to the pretzels, try melting some peanut butter and drizzle it over the top of the bars. You could also melt peanut butter chips and drizzle that. 
  • Fudge Layer : If you want more peanut butter flavor try using half milk chocolate chips + half peanut butter chips for the fudge layer.
